Typical Insurance Dispute Scenarios and How to Resolve Them
Insurance disputes can be a painful experience, but understanding common scenarios and knowing how to handle them can make the process smoother. Common source of conflict is disagreement over coverage. Policies can be complex, leading to confusion about what events are protected. Another typical dispute involves claims handling. Insurers may disagree on the value of damages or the speed with which a claim is resolved.
To successfully address these disputes, it's essential to carefully review your policy documents and understand your rights and obligations. Negotiate openly and honestly with your insurer, documenting all interactions. If you can't reach a mutually acceptable resolution on your own, consider seeking the assistance of an insurance agent or attorney.
